MicroRNA (miRNA) analysis

MicroRNA (miRNA) analysis

Solutions for miRNA research. miRNAs are small, noncoding RNA molecules that direct post-transcriptional suppression of gene expression.

Protein expression analysis

Protein expression analysis

TaqMan Protein assays combine the protein-binding of antibodies with the quantitation of real-time PCR. They enable fast, easy identification of proteins from small samples in a homogeneous assay format.
